Output e8f17813c736080bf2aca7f35872b832295aae683804d0c31d7685c784677a87:26

value
406125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188606455bb66ce97f0c45fc9f191262bc9c5403 OP_EQUAL
address
MA8q1Dg7oa6WgyD2AptoWcc6cVaYVDgQQR
transaction
e8f17813c736080bf2aca7f35872b832295aae683804d0c31d7685c784677a87
spent
true